Review | Open Access

Another special role of L-spaces-evolution equations and Lotz' theorem

Abstract

In this paper, we review the underappreciated theorem by Lotz that tells us that every strongly continuous operator semigroup on a Grothendieck space with the Dunford-Pettis property is automatically uniformly continuous. A large class of spaces that carry these geometric properties are L(Ω,Σ,μ) for non-negative measure spaces. This shows once again that L-spaces have to be treated differently.
